Output e8db5319b3f12f9f4c0cfdb2517a66e731e6b25a520276d1c3f2734fa3706a6a:3

value
3763407846
script pubkey
OP_0 OP_PUSHBYTES_20 6f370df566093a389c764ef000ecc1cc0e70dd04
address
bc1qdumsmatxpyar38rkfmcqpmxpes88phgyvujywn
transaction
e8db5319b3f12f9f4c0cfdb2517a66e731e6b25a520276d1c3f2734fa3706a6a
confirmations
113
spent
true